Output 0543fd67990f57388658b7296f2219ee98314d8b41a60572d1886ba7f0dabc81:1

value
577500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3491226b12ceddb904ff3682a5ae683f072552b OP_EQUAL
address
3PsPfDMmKAiFKM9ZPKzWNMvWNnGDnChSG5
transaction
0543fd67990f57388658b7296f2219ee98314d8b41a60572d1886ba7f0dabc81
spent
true